Problem 3
Determine the FM Bandwidth required to transmit a Carrier Signal modulated with a 5 kHz signal and the carrier has a maximum deviation of 10 kHz . Use the attached Table 5-2. Plot the Frequency Spectrum over the Bandwidth.
Problem 4
Given the following FM Signal: applied to a 100-Ohm Antenna; find the following: (a) Carrier Frequency, fc; (b) Transmitted Power, Pc; (c) Modulation-Index, mf; (d) Intelligence Signal Frequency, fi; (e) Bandwidth, BW; and ( f ) In each of the Sideband(s) predicted by Table 5-2.
Problem 5
In an attempt to minimize the effect of the low gain of the highest frequencies the FM Signal, two (2) two techniques are used; one is applied in the Transmitter and the other in the Receiver:
(A) Name these techniques, and state where each is used.
(B) Describe at least one of these techniques and show the simple circuit use to perform the operation described.
